Abstract
A multi-monitor computer system includes a plurality of display devices communicating with at least one computing device executing an application management procedure. The application management procedure enables an application window available on one display device to be moved entirely to another display device by selecting the other display device from a dialog box displayed in response to a pointer-dragging input gesture on the application window.

2. A method of managing applications in a multi-monitor computer system comprising a plurality of display devices, said method comprising:
-
receiving a pointer-dragging input gesture on an application window; in the event that a threshold condition is satisfied by the input gesture, automatically displaying a dialog box with a plurality of potential destination display devices; receiving the user'"'"'s selection of a destination display device; and in response to the user'"'"'s selection, moving the application window entirely into the selected destination display device.
